So, even tho I feel taken, I don;t feel alone. Thank you all for reading and trying to help, JIMJim,
SATA is great for a hard drive, but I don't see the point of having SATA on a CD/DVD burner. SATA is capable of transferring data WAY FASTER than a CD drive runs, either reading or writing.
IDE is more than satisfactory for a DVD burner.

On that mobo, however, you SHOULD be running a SATA hard drive.
All SATA hard drives on the store shelves today are SATA2.....twice as fast as SATA(1).
A retail SATA drive will usually COME with the SATA1 jumper in place on the back of the drive for compatibility with older motherboards.
To use the drive on a SATA2 mobo, the jumper will have to be removed or the mobo won't even see the drive.

Thanks??? There is nothing to fear, as long as you don't open up the PC when its running and stick your fingers or a screwdriver in there. When it is running it's grounded through the plug, so that's safe. when the PC is off and your inside the case you should, at least, wear a ESD wrist, ER, thing. (forgot the exact term). I use one of these and a anti-static mat. Components should be placed in an anti-static bag.

Years (and years) ago, no-body bothered about static so much. But i'm a firm believer in 'if its not broke then don't brake it'. Its worth using ESD wrist bands because they are actually quite cheap and if you compere that with blowing your motherboard then you can see it's worth it.

If your GOING to vacuum you should use a anti-static vacuum cleaner. They are made ESPECIALLY for cleaning PC's. Vacuum cleaners actually create static.Also, computer case is made out of metal, and it works as Faraday cage. Enclosure like this blocks out external static electrical fields.

The 8800GT and 9800GT are the same card. The 9800GT (well, some of them) use 55nm technology and THUS RUN cooler, performance is the same. Also, the 9800GT supports 3-way SLI, which the 8800GT does not.
Neither is much of an improvement over a 9600GT though.well, I found a deal on Newegg.com that let me get the EVGA 9800 CHEAPER than the EVGA 8800

Check the specs too: they both have 112 stream processors, 600MHz core, 1500MHz shader, 1800MHz memory clocks.
It's actually possible, from what I've read, to flash the 8800GT to a 9800GT BIOS, to change the name - clicky - although I don't recommend this.

Quote from: ThrowingShapes on November 22, 2008, 08:02:47 PM
I was under the impression that 8800gt's run on a 65nm core and a 9800 runs on a 55nm core.

As I said, some 9800GTs are 55nm and some aren't. Seems Nvidia cleared out their old stock of 8800GT cards by flashing the 9800GT BIOS and then started a 55nm process when they'd got rid of the older cards. Some speculation, but I've heard that elsewhere too, just don't recall where.
